Natural Gas Outdoor Kitchen Charlotte County: My Framework for 99.9% Uptime in High-Humidity Zones

I’ve lost count of the number of high-end outdoor kitchens I’ve been called to fix in Charlotte County, from waterfront properties in Punta Gorda Isles to expansive lanais in Rotonda West. The common denominator is almost never a faulty grill; it's a systemic failure in design and installation that completely overlooks our unique Southwest Florida climate. Most contractors apply generic building practices, resulting in premature corrosion, anemic flame performance, and eventual failure. My entire approach is built around preempting these issues, ensuring your investment performs flawlessly through intense summer humidity and salty air.

The core problem lies in two areas most builders ignore: gas supply dynamics and material science under duress. A natural gas line isn't just a pipe; it's a delivery system that must maintain consistent pressure based on the total BTU load of all your appliances. I’ve seen projects where a powerful grill is starved for fuel because it’s sharing an undersized line with a side burner and a fire pit. My methodology corrects this at the source, focusing on a robust fuel-delivery architecture and materials specified for our coastal environment, not for a dry climate.

My Diagnostic Protocol for Coastal Kitchen Failure

Before any design work begins, I perform what I call a "Hostile Environment Audit." This isn't about picking colors; it's about identifying the specific environmental stressors at your property. A home on a canal in Port Charlotte faces a different level of salt spray and humidity than a home further inland. My audit focuses on the three silent killers of outdoor kitchens in our region: atmospheric corrosion, inadequate BTU delivery, and trapped moisture within the kitchen island's structure.

I once consulted on a project in an Englewood beachside home where a six-month-old, $15,000 outdoor kitchen was already showing significant rust pitting. The builder used 304-grade stainless steel, a standard choice that is completely inadequate for our salt-laden air. This single error doomed the project from the start. My diagnostic protocol would have immediately flagged this, specifying a superior material and saving the homeowner a fortune. It’s this level of upfront analysis that prevents catastrophic and costly failures down the line.

Technical Deep Dive: Gas Flow and Material Integrity

Let's get technical. The heart of a high-performance natural gas kitchen is the gas line. The critical metric here is the Total BTU Load. You must sum the maximum BTU rating of every single appliance you plan to install. A 60,000 BTU grill plus a 25,000 BTU side burner requires a system capable of delivering 85,000 BTUs simultaneously without a pressure drop. I use a proprietary formula that accounts for the length of the pipe run from the meter and the number of fittings (each elbow adds "equivalent feet" of pipe, increasing friction loss) to specify the correct pipe diameter. Failing to do this is the primary reason for weak, yellow flames and poor heating performance.

Regarding materials, the distinction is simple but critical. For any property east of I-75 in Charlotte County, you can generally get by with high-quality 304-grade stainless components. However, for any home west of the interstate, especially those on or near the water, I mandate 316L marine-grade stainless steel. The "L" stands for low carbon, and the addition of molybdenum in its chemical composition gives it vastly superior resistance to chlorides (salt). Furthermore, the kitchen's enclosure must have engineered cross-ventilation. I insist on installing vents at both high and low points on opposing sides of the island to prevent heat and moisture from stagnating, which accelerates corrosion and can create a serious safety hazard.

The Charlotte County Implementation Blueprint

Executing a durable and high-performance natural gas outdoor kitchen requires a rigid, sequential process. Deviating from this is how mistakes happen. After years of refining my approach on local projects, this is my non-negotiable checklist for every installation.

  • Verify Gas Meter Capacity: Before anything else, I check with Teco Peoples Gas or the relevant utility to ensure the property's meter and service line can handle the additional load of the outdoor kitchen.
  • Calculate Total BTU Load: I create a manifest of all gas appliances and sum their maximum BTU ratings to determine the total system demand.
  • Map the Optimal Pipe Route: I design the shortest, most direct path for the new gas line to minimize pressure loss and installation cost.
  • Specify Black Iron Pipe or CSST: I determine the correct material and diameter for the gas line based on the BTU load and run length calculation. All underground portions must be factory-coated and protected.
  • Mandate a Drip Leg: A sediment trap (drip leg) must be installed on the line just before the appliance connection point. This is a simple vertical pipe section that catches moisture and particulates, protecting the sensitive burner controls.
  • Specify 316L Grade Components: For coastal-proximate builds, all access doors, drawers, and appliance facias must be 316L grade stainless steel. No exceptions.
  • Engineer Enclosure Ventilation: The island structure must include at least two vents on opposing walls, creating a passive airflow to dissipate heat and moisture. This is a critical safety step.

Precision Tuning for Peak Performance and Longevity

The job isn't finished when the last connection is tightened. The final 10% of the work is what guarantees longevity and perfect operation. First, I conduct a system pressure test. The entire gas line is pressurized to 1.5 times its working pressure and must hold that pressure for a minimum of 30 minutes with zero loss, ensuring there are absolutely no leaks.

Next comes the burner calibration. Once gas is flowing, I meticulously adjust the air shutters on each burner. The goal is a crisp, blue flame with a light-blue tip. A yellow, smoky flame indicates incomplete combustion, which means wasted fuel, sooty cooking surfaces, and poor heat output. I also ensure all stainless steel components are passivated. This is a chemical cleaning process that removes any free iron from the surface, enhancing the material's natural chromium oxide layer and boosting its corrosion resistance by an estimated 30%.

Natural Gas Outdoor Kitchen in Charlotte FL FAQ

Do I need a dedicated natural gas line for my outdoor kitchen, or can I just tap into an existing one?
You absolutely need a dedicated, properly sized gas line run directly from your meter or main supply line for the outdoor kitchen. Tapping into an existing line, such as one for a fireplace or water heater, will almost certainly lead to insufficient gas pressure, causing your high-demand grill and burners to underperform and potentially creating a hazardous situation. The new line must be calculated based on the total BTU load of all your planned appliances and the distance of the run to ensure everything operates safely and effectively.
My natural gas grill isn't getting hot enough. Is the grill broken?
Before blaming the grill, verify the gas supply line is adequately sized for the grill's BTU rating and the distance from the source. An undersized pipe, typically less than 3/4-inch for most setups, is the most common cause of low flame and poor heating performance, as it restricts the required volume of gas. Also, check that the shut-off valve is fully open and that the regulator, if one is installed, is functioning correctly and is rated for natural gas, not propane.
Can I use my old propane grill or appliances with a new natural gas line?
You cannot directly connect propane appliances to a natural gas line without modifying them with a specific conversion kit. Propane and natural gas operate at different pressures and require different sized orifices in the burners; using the wrong fuel will result in dangerously large, sooty flames and incomplete combustion. While many manufacturers offer a conversion kit, some high-end or older models are not designed to be converted, so confirm availability for your specific appliance before planning the installation.
What are the safety requirements for running a natural gas line underground to my patio?
Underground natural gas lines must be buried at a specific depth, typically 18 to 24 inches, to protect them from accidental damage. The pipe material must be approved for direct burial, and a yellow tracer wire must be run alongside it so the line can be located electronically in the future. All underground piping requires a licensed plumber for installation, and the work must be inspected and pressure-tested to meet local building codes before the trench is backfilled to prevent dangerous leaks.
Is an emergency gas shut-off valve required for the outdoor kitchen itself?
Yes, local codes almost universally require an easily accessible emergency shut-off valve located within a few feet of the appliances. This allows for a quick shutdown of the gas supply to the entire kitchen in case of a fire or significant leak, without needing to access the main meter. Omitting this critical safety feature is a common mistake in DIY installations and will cause the project to fail a safety inspection, not to mention creating a serious hazard for your home and family.
Does my outdoor kitchen need to be a certain distance from my house if it uses natural gas?
Yes, there are strict clearance requirements for locating natural gas appliances, especially high-heat grills. You must maintain a minimum distance from combustible materials, including house siding, deck railings, and overhead structures, as specified by both the appliance manufacturer and local fire codes. A common minimum is 36 inches from any combustible wall, but this can be greater for very high-BTU units. Ignoring these clearance-to-combustibles rules is a primary cause of structure fires originating from outdoor kitchens.
